Thale Noi
22km from Khao Ok Talu
Thale Noi, also spelled Talay Noi is an internationally recognized and protected wetland in Phatthalung province covering more than 400km² and home to thousands of bird species. Phatthalung province receives comparatively far fewer foreign tourists than other Southern destinations such as Phuket, and Krabi.
Khao Pu - Khao Ya National Park
24.99km from Khao Ok Talu
The name of the national park was named after the name of the famous mountain within the area. Especially, the name "KhaoPu" where local people believe the spirit of "Ta Pu", half man half god, is situated. The place is then crowded with people coming by to pay homage to the sacred mountain. This national park is situated in the area of Bantad Mountain.

Songkhla National Museum
72.19km from Khao Ok Talu
It was used as the governor's palace for a short time then converted to National Museum in 1982. It exhibits a wide-ranging collection of artifacts from the province's past.

Wat Phra Mahathat Woramahawihan
88.51km from Khao Ok Talu
Wat Phra Mahathat Woramahawihan is the main Buddhist temple of Nakhon Si Thammarat Province, the largest province in Southern Thailand. It is located on the main sand bar of Nakhon Si Thammarat on which the ancient town and the present town of Nakhon Si Thammarat were built.

Khao Ok Talu
Khao Ok Talu, Khuha Sawan, Mueang Phatthalung District, Phatthalung 93000, Thailand
From Wat Khuha Sawan, follow Highway 4047 and Khao Ok Thalu or Mount Ok Thalu will be seen standing majestically to the east of the railway station. It is a symbolic figure of Phatthalung, having a height of around 250m. There is a flight of stairs leading the way up to the mountaintop overlooking the city of Phatthalung. The distinctive feature is a hole near the top, where visitors can see through it.
